what exactly is Grave possession?

Grave possession refers to the lawful right to your burial plot in a cemetery. This suitable ordinarily involves the authority to determine who can be buried during the plot, the type of memorial which might be put on it, and also the repairs of your grave. It’s critical to recognize that grave possession isn't the same as land possession. When you buy a burial plot, you happen to be shopping for the distinctive legal rights of burial for a specified interval, often ranging from twenty five to 100 yrs, dependant upon local polices and cemetery insurance policies.

distinctive Right of Burial

The "special suitable of burial" is usually a crucial component of grave possession. This ideal makes it possible for the grave operator to determine who can be interred while in the plot and to make selections with regards to the memorials or headstones put on it. possession of these legal rights does not equate to proudly owning the land alone, which continues to be beneath the control of the cemetery or local council. It is also vital that you understand that following the period of possession expires, the rights may be renewed In case the owner dreams and if the cemetery permits.

Transferring Grave Ownership

The transfer of grave possession can be a legal method which allows a burial plot to vary palms from a single man or woman to a different. This transfer can occur for various reasons, including the Loss of life of the present owner, the necessity to get a new loved one to take control of the grave, or a alter in household dynamics. Regardless of the rationale, the method will involve unique legal ways to ensure the transfer is legitimate and recognized via the cemetery or nearby authorities.

factors for Transferring Grave Ownership

you'll find various predicaments where by transferring grave possession will become essential:

  1. Loss of life on the Grave operator: When the grave owner passes absent, their rights for the grave might be transferred for their upcoming of kin or to a person named of their will.
  2. relatives Decisions: often, households may perhaps opt to transfer ownership to a completely new member who is more capable of maintaining the grave or running its affairs.
  3. Sale of Ownership legal rights: sometimes, grave ownership rights may be sold to another get together, Whilst That is much less popular and subject to cemetery regulations.
  4. Inheritance: If the initial proprietor still left the burial legal rights inside their will, the grave possession is going to be handed on to the person named within the will.

lawful Documentation essential

Transferring grave possession needs specific documentation to guarantee the procedure is carried out legally and thoroughly recorded. The exact needs may change depending upon the cemetery or neighborhood authorities, but typically, the subsequent paperwork are vital:

  1. Grave Deed: the first deed or certificate that proves possession of the burial plot. This doc is essential for validating the transfer.
  2. Will or Probate: Should the transfer is happening a result of the death of the owner, the deceased’s will or probate files will probably be required to prove The brand new operator's proper to the grave.
  3. sort of Assignment: A lawful sort that formally transfers the rights in the grave from one unique to another. this kind may well should be signed before a witness or solicitor.
  4. subsequent of Kin Affidavit: In conditions the place no will exists, a future of kin affidavit can be required to confirm who has the legal proper to inherit the grave possession.

The Process of Transferring Grave Ownership

the method for transferring grave possession could range determined by local policies, but normally follows these basic measures:

  1. receive the demanded paperwork: the initial step is to collect all important documents, including the original grave deed, Dying certificates, and authorized sorts linked to inheritance or assignment.
  2. Make contact with the Cemetery Authority: Reach out on the cemetery where the burial plot is situated to notify them of the specified transfer. The cemetery may perhaps offer forms or instructions for finishing the transfer.
  3. entire and post Forms: right after acquiring the required varieties, full them thoroughly, making certain all facts is exact. Submit the varieties as well as any supporting documentation into the cemetery authority.
  4. Pay Transfer service fees: Some cemeteries may possibly demand a fee for processing the transfer of possession. Be sure to talk to about any involved expenditures upfront to stop surprises.
  5. Update Cemetery data: Once the transfer is permitted, the cemetery will update their documents to mirror the new operator. It's also advisable to get a new deed or certification of ownership as proof of the transfer.

worries in Transferring Grave possession

when transferring grave possession is often easy, you can find particular troubles that could crop up. knowledge these potential issues beforehand will help you get ready and stay away from issues.

Multiple Claimants

Among the most popular worries takes place when multiple members of the family have an curiosity while in the grave, specially if the initial operator did not depart a will. In these cases, it could be needed for the family to come back to an agreement about who'll acquire ownership or for that subject to generally be settled in probate courtroom.

shed Deeds

If the original grave deed continues to be missing or misplaced, transferring possession is usually additional elaborate. In these types of situations, you might have to make an application for a replica deed or verify possession by way of other legal signifies, which can consider further effort and time.

nearby polices

every single cemetery has its very own set of policies and regulations regarding the transfer of grave possession. These rules will vary greatly, so it’s important to talk to the cemetery authority and comprehend the specific requirements in advance of continuing With all the transfer.
